ABSTRACT

The most active ingredient in turmeric is curcumin. In addition to using turmeric as a spice to improve the taste, aroma, and color of foods, it also has several health benefits. Considering the very beneficial effects of this plant polyphenol in scientific studies, the use of curcumin as a natural, inexpensive, and safe dietary supplement is gaining popularity. The present review summarizes the trials conducted in the Middle East using curcumin on different aspects of human health and conditions.
